Speaker's Profile

Ariffin Sha
Founder and Editor-in-Chief
Wake Up Singapore

Ariffin firmly believes in the need for accessible, consistent, and simple narratives. In recent years, in addition to socio-political issues, Wake Up Singapore has expanded to cover lifestyle matters and engage in PR work, particularly in the field of crisis communications and media monitoring.
Despite a paucity of resources, Wake Up Singapore commands a large following that cuts across different demographics of Singaporeans. It positions itself as the go-to platform for news with views. It aims to shed light on perspectives and issues that warrant greater public attention and discussion.
